摘要
The histochemical and phase contrast observations on the embryonic envelopes enclosing the acanthor of Acanthosentis sp. reveal the presence of 3 layers. All 3 layers are non-refractile during early stages of formation and become refringent subsequently. The outer layer loses its refractile property together with affinity for acid and basic dyes when the eggs are fully developed. This layer is neither tanned nor chitinous. The 2nd layer consists of glyco-lipo protein aceous matrix. The polysaccharide moiety is identified to be strongly sulfated acid mucopolysaccharide. The lipid component is characterized to be KOH resistant and esters of unsaturated fatty acid. The protein is rich in aromatic amino acids. The 3rd and innermost layer contains chitin and acid mucopolysacchardies. The protein is rich in S-containing amino acids. Sulphydryl groups were present during early stages of its formation, but forms disulfhide cross-links subsequently. Stages in the development of acanthors were characterized with reference to the formation of envelopes. The permeability experiments carried out on fresh eggs using 0.1% aqueous solutions of bromophenol blue, methylene blue, toluidine blue, basic fuchsin and neutral red indicate that the inward diffusion of these substances is prevented subsequent to formation of disulfide groups in the innermost layer. The embryo probably derives nutritive requirements from the pseudocoel fluid of the female worm through the envelopes covering it.
